Weather in June

June, the first month of the summer in Maysfield, is a tropical month, with temperature in the range of an average high of 90.3°F (32.4°C) and an average low of 72.1°F (22.3°C).

Temperature

June witnesses a minor rise in the average high-temperature, transitioning from a warm 82.9°F (28.3°C) in May to a hot 90.3°F (32.4°C). Maysfield experiences a consistent average temperature of 72.1°F (22.3°C) throughout the nights in June.

Heat index

June's mean heat index is estimated at a scorching 109.4°F (43°C). On guard: Heat exhaustion and heat cramps are predicted. Heatstroke is a potential hazard with continuous physical effort.
When considering the heat index, it's pivotal to note it is for shade and mild wind conditions. The heat index has the possibility to be enhanced by 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ees when there is direct sun exposure.
Note: The heat index, also known as 'apparent temperature' or 'real feel', is what the temperature feels like to the human body when the air temperature is combined with the relative humidity. A person's impression of weather can be shaped by many aspects, among them metabolic variations, pregnancy, and levels of physical activity. In direct sunlight, the heat's impact can be heightened, potentially leading to an increase in the heat index by 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ees. Heat index values are highly important for children. Kids frequently ignore the importance of taking a break and rehydrating. Thirst is a late symptom of dehydration - thus, it is crucial to stay hydrated, especially during long-lasting physical activities.
Evaporating sweat, an outcome of perspiration, is key in assisting the human body to moderate its temperature. Relative humidity in excess curtails evaporation, therefore reducing heat dissipation from the body, leading to feelings of excess heat. The body faces dehydration threats when its cooling efforts are outpaced by excessive heat gain.

Humidity

In Maysfield, the average relative humidity in June is 74%.

Rainfall

In Maysfield, in June, it is raining for 8.2 days, with typically 0.79" (20mm) of accumulated precipitation. Throughout the year, in Maysfield, Texas, there are 92.9 rainfall days, and 8.07" (205mm) of precipitation is accumulated.

Snowfall

January, March through December are months without snowfall in Maysfield.

Daylight

With an average of 14h and 6min of daylight, June has the longest days of the year.
On the first day of June, sunrise is at 6:24 am and sunset at 8:26 pm. On the last day of the month, sunrise is at 6:27 am and sunset at 8:34 pm CDT.

Sunshine

In Maysfield, the average sunshine in June is 9.5h.

UV index

The months with the highest UV index are June through August, with an average maximum UV index of 7. A UV Index estimate of 6 to 7 represents a high health vulnerability from exposure to the Sun's UV radiation for average individuals.
Note: In June, the average maximum UV index of 7 translates into the following recommendations:
Take precautions against overexposure. Fair-skinned people may get burned in less than 20 minutes. From 10 a.m. to 4 p.m., when UV radiation is at its strongest, limit direct exposure to the Sun and note that shade structures may not provide full sun protection. On bright days sunglasses that block both UVA and UVB rays should be worn. A hat with a wide brim is extremely helpful, as it can prevent roughly 50% of UV radiation from reaching the eyes.
